Can hybrid photovoltaic/wind renewable systems provide mobile phone base transceiver stations?
Kanzumba et al. [ 2] investigated the possibility of using hybrid photovoltaic/wind renewable systems as primary sources of energy to supply mobile telephone base transceiver stations in the rural regions of the Republic of the Congo.
Can a hybrid power system feed a stand-alone DC load?
The modelling and size optimisation of such hybrid systems feeding a stand-alone direct current (DC) load at a telecom base station have been carried out using the HOMER software. Vincent et al. [ 15] proposed a hybrid (solar and hydro) and DG system based on the power system models for powering stand-alone BS sites.

What are flywheel energy storage systems?
Flywheel energy storage systems are suitable and economical when frequent charge and discharge cycles are required. Furthermore, flywheel batteries have high power density and a low environmental footprint. Various techniques are being employed to improve the efficiency of the flywheel, including the use of composite materials.
How do fly wheels store energy?
Fly wheels store energy in mechanical rotational energy to be then converted into the required power form when required. Energy storage is a vital component of any power system, as the stored energy can be used to offset inconsistencies in the power delivery system.

What are the advantages of flywheel batteries?
So, one of the advantages presented by flywheel batteries is that stored energy and output power are nearly independent variables in the system design. Energy storage flywheels are generally useful in power conditioning applications, i.e., when there is a mismatch between the power generated and the power required by the load.

How much energy is stored in a composite flywheel?
Typical energies stored in a single unit range from less than a kilowatt-hour to levels approaching 150 kilowatt-hours. Thus, a single composite flywheel can be equivalent, in stored energy, from one to more than 100 automotive batteries. Moreover, in flywheel systems, the stored energy and output power are relatively independent of each other.
